Understanding Your Requirements and Preferences
What variables affect a person's choice in between buying and renting a home? Personal scenarios play a considerable function in this option. Financial stability is vital; those with adequate cost savings and consistent earnings are much more inclined to acquire, while individuals encountering uncertainty might favor renting out for adaptability. Furthermore, way of life choices, such as the wish for flexibility or a long-term dedication to a neighborhood, heavily impact the choice.
Family members factors to consider, such as the requirement for room or distance to workplaces and colleges, likewise entered play. A person's age and job stage can influence the selection; as an example, younger specialists could lean towards renting, focusing on benefit, whereas families might seek the permanence of possession. Eventually, understanding individual requirements, future strategies, and monetary capabilities is essential in figuring out whether to purchase or rent, leading individuals to make educated choices that line up with their life goals.

Establishing a Realistic Spending Plan
Setting a reasonable budget plan is crucial for anyone contemplating the purchase or rental of a building. A distinct spending plan permits people to recognize what they can truly manage, protecting against financial strain and potential remorse. It is essential to consider not just the month-to-month settlements yet additionally added prices such as property taxes, insurance, maintenance, and energies.
People must likewise evaluate their current financial situation, consisting of revenue, financial savings, and existing financial debts. Checking Out Funding Options
Exactly how can possible purchasers and occupants navigate the complicated landscape of funding options? Comprehending the numerous financing opportunities is essential for making notified choices. Traditional home mortgages remain a prominent selection, supplying repaired or adjustable rates and differing terms. Customers may likewise take into consideration government-backed fundings, such as FHA or VA financings, which offer positive terms for qualified people.
For those seeking to rent, some might discover rent-to-own arrangements, enabling them to slowly purchase a residential or commercial property while staying in it. In addition, individual car loans or lines of credit rating can supplement funding, albeit typically at higher rate of interest prices.
Financiers may likewise think about collaborations or crowdfunding systems, diversifying their monetary sources. Ultimately, carrying out complete study and getting in touch with economic experts can assist clear up the most suitable financing alternatives customized to private scenarios and goals.

Tips for Assessing Residence
Reviewing homes needs a systematic approach to guarantee educated decisions are made. Possible buyers or renters need to start by taking a look at place, taking into consideration distance to necessary facilities, institutions, and transportation options. Next off, they ought to look into the residential or commercial property's condition, looking for structural problems, required repair services, and total maintenance. A complete examination can expose surprise issues that may sustain future costs.
